Transaction 331c2dc588d5b2437ad5ad5c98d9f79e30592e02ef6c011865dd6761e12c31b5

4 Input
2 Outputs
  • 331c2dc588d5b2437ad5ad5c98d9f79e30592e02ef6c011865dd6761e12c31b5:0
  • value  7668000000
    address  3AfGZKjRvxtuFkKjen4sLKqL6pATW3X4AG
  • 331c2dc588d5b2437ad5ad5c98d9f79e30592e02ef6c011865dd6761e12c31b5:1
  • value  388267352
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n